How they compare

Kuwait currently reports 1.62 billion Domestic currency against 1.37 billion Domestic currency in Lesotho, a difference of 254.17 million Domestic currency.

That makes Kuwait's figure about 1.2 times Lesotho's.

Across all 20 years both countries report, Kuwait has been ahead every year.

Kuwait ranks 122nd and Lesotho ranks 125th of 145 countries.

Kuwait has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
